Skip to content

Commit 12a67bc

Browse files
authored
chore: include updates to metadata from RHDH... (#1622)
chore: include updates to metadata from RHDH main branch's dynamic-plugins.default.yaml (DPDY) that were missing in the catalog-entities/marketplace/packages/*.yaml files (RHIDP-9835) Assisted-by: Cursor Signed-off-by: Nick Boldt <[email protected]>
1 parent c7b25d2 commit 12a67bc

17 files changed

+812
-717
lines changed

workspaces/adoption-insights/metadata/rhdh-backstage-plugin-adoption-insights.yaml

Lines changed: 32 additions & 29 deletions
Original file line numberDiff line numberDiff line change
@@ -3,20 +3,19 @@ kind: Package
33
metadata:
44
name: rhdh-backstage-plugin-adoption-insights
55
namespace: rhdh
6-
title: "Adoption Insights Frontend"
6+
title: Adoption Insights Frontend
77
links:
8-
- url: https://red.ht/rhdh
9-
title: Homepage
10-
- url: https://issues.redhat.com/browse/RHIDP
11-
title: Bugs
12-
- title: Source Code
13-
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-adoption-insights
8+
- url: https://red.ht/rhdh
9+
title: Homepage
10+
- url: https://issues.redhat.com/browse/RHIDP
11+
title: Bugs
12+
- title: Source Code
13+
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-adoption-insights
1414
annotations:
15-
backstage.io/source-location: url
16-
https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-adoption-insights
15+
backstage.io/source-location: url https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-adoption-insights
1716
tags: []
1817
spec:
19-
packageName: "@red-hat-developer-hub/backstage-plugin-adoption-insights"
18+
packageName: '@red-hat-developer-hub/backstage-plugin-adoption-insights'
2019
dynamicArtifact: ./dynamic-plugins/dist/red-hat-developer-hub-backstage-plugin-adoption-insights
2120
version: 0.2.1
2221
backstage:
@@ -26,23 +25,27 @@ spec:
2625
support: production
2726
lifecycle: active
2827
partOf:
29-
- adoption-insights
28+
- adoption-insights
3029
appConfigExamples:
31-
- title: Default configuration
32-
content:
33-
dynamicPlugins:
34-
frontend:
35-
red-hat-developer-hub.backstage-plugin-adoption-insights:
36-
appIcons:
37-
- name: adoptionInsightsIcon
38-
importName: AdoptionInsightsIcon
39-
dynamicRoutes:
40-
- path: /adoption-insights
41-
importName: AdoptionInsightsPage
42-
menuItem:
43-
icon: adoptionInsightsIcon
44-
text: Adoption Insights
45-
menuItems:
46-
adoption-insights:
47-
parent: admin
48-
icon: adoptionInsightsIcon
30+
- title: Default configuration
31+
content:
32+
dynamicPlugins:
33+
frontend:
34+
red-hat-developer-hub.backstage-plugin-adoption-insights:
35+
translationResources:
36+
- importName: adoptionInsightsTranslations
37+
ref: adoptionInsightsTranslationRef
38+
appIcons:
39+
- name: adoptionInsightsIcon
40+
importName: AdoptionInsightsIcon
41+
dynamicRoutes:
42+
- path: /adoption-insights
43+
importName: AdoptionInsightsPage
44+
menuItem:
45+
icon: adoptionInsightsIcon
46+
text: Adoption Insights
47+
textKey: menuItem.adoptionInsights
48+
menuItems:
49+
adoption-insights:
50+
parent: default.admin
51+
icon: adoptionInsightsIcon

workspaces/backstage/metadata/backstage-plugin-catalog-backend-module-ldap.yaml

Lines changed: 36 additions & 17 deletions
Original file line numberDiff line numberDiff line change
@@ -3,21 +3,20 @@ kind: Package
33
metadata:
44
name: backstage-plugin-catalog-backend-module-ldap
55
namespace: rhdh
6-
title: "Catalog Backend Module LDAP"
6+
title: Catalog Backend Module LDAP
77
links:
8-
- url: https://red.ht/rhdh
9-
title: Homepage
10-
- url: https://issues.redhat.com/browse/RHIDP
11-
title: Bugs
12-
- title: Source Code
13-
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/backstage-plugin-catalog-backend-module-ldap-dynamic
8+
- url: https://red.ht/rhdh
9+
title: Homepage
10+
- url: https://issues.redhat.com/browse/RHIDP
11+
title: Bugs
12+
- title: Source Code
13+
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/backstage-plugin-catalog-backend-module-ldap-dynamic
1414
annotations:
15-
backstage.io/source-location: url
16-
https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/backstage-plugin-catalog-backend-module-ldap-dynamic
15+
backstage.io/source-location: url https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/backstage-plugin-catalog-backend-module-ldap-dynamic
1716
tags:
18-
- software-catalog
17+
- software-catalog
1918
spec:
20-
packageName: "@backstage/plugin-catalog-backend-module-ldap"
19+
packageName: '@backstage/plugin-catalog-backend-module-ldap'
2120
dynamicArtifact: ./dynamic-plugins/dist/backstage-plugin-catalog-backend-module-ldap-dynamic
2221
version: 0.11.8
2322
backstage:
@@ -27,10 +26,30 @@ spec:
2726
support: production
2827
lifecycle: active
2928
partOf:
30-
- ldap-catalog-integration
29+
- ldap-catalog-integration
3130
appConfigExamples:
32-
- title: Default configuration
33-
content:
34-
catalog:
35-
providers:
36-
ldapOrg: {}
31+
- title: Default configuration
32+
content:
33+
catalog:
34+
providers:
35+
ldapOrg:
36+
default:
37+
target: ${LDAP_TARGET_URL}
38+
bind:
39+
dn: ${LDAP_BIND_DN}
40+
secret: ${LDAP_BIND_SECRET}
41+
users:
42+
- dn: ${LDAP_USERS_DN}
43+
options:
44+
filter: (uid=*)
45+
groups:
46+
- dn: ${LDAP_GROUPS_DN}
47+
options:
48+
filter: (cn=*)
49+
schedule:
50+
frequency:
51+
minutes: 60
52+
initialDelay:
53+
seconds: 15
54+
timeout:
55+
minutes: 15

workspaces/backstage/metadata/backstage-plugin-techdocs.yaml

Lines changed: 53 additions & 53 deletions
Original file line numberDiff line numberDiff line change
@@ -3,20 +3,19 @@ kind: Package
33
metadata:
44
name: backstage-plugin-techdocs
55
namespace: rhdh
6-
title: "TechDocs Frontend"
6+
title: TechDocs Frontend
77
links:
8-
- url: https://red.ht/rhdh
9-
title: Homepage
10-
- url: https://issues.redhat.com/browse/RHIDP
11-
title: Bugs
12-
- title: Source Code
13-
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/backstage-plugin-techdocs
8+
- url: https://red.ht/rhdh
9+
title: Homepage
10+
- url: https://issues.redhat.com/browse/RHIDP
11+
title: Bugs
12+
- title: Source Code
13+
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/backstage-plugin-techdocs
1414
annotations:
15-
backstage.io/source-location: url
16-
https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/backstage-plugin-techdocs
15+
backstage.io/source-location: url https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/backstage-plugin-techdocs
1716
tags: []
1817
spec:
19-
packageName: "@backstage/plugin-techdocs"
18+
packageName: '@backstage/plugin-techdocs'
2019
dynamicArtifact: ./dynamic-plugins/dist/backstage-plugin-techdocs
2120
version: 1.14.1
2221
backstage:
@@ -26,47 +25,48 @@ spec:
2625
support: production
2726
lifecycle: active
2827
partOf:
29-
- techdocs
28+
- techdocs
3029
appConfigExamples:
31-
- title: Default configuration
32-
content:
33-
dynamicPlugins:
34-
frontend:
35-
backstage.plugin-techdocs:
36-
routeBindings:
37-
targets:
38-
- importName: techdocsPlugin
39-
bindings:
40-
- bindTarget: catalogPlugin.externalRoutes
41-
bindMap:
42-
viewTechDoc: techdocsPlugin.routes.docRoot
43-
- bindTarget: scaffolderPlugin.externalRoutes
44-
bindMap:
45-
viewTechDoc: techdocsPlugin.routes.docRoot
46-
dynamicRoutes:
47-
- path: /docs
48-
importName: TechDocsIndexPage
49-
menuItem:
50-
icon: docs
51-
text: Docs
52-
- path: /docs/:namespace/:kind/:name/*
53-
importName: TechDocsReaderPage
54-
mountPoints:
55-
- mountPoint: entity.page.docs/cards
56-
importName: EntityTechdocsContent
57-
config:
58-
layout:
59-
gridColumn: 1 / -1
60-
if:
61-
allOf:
62-
- isTechDocsAvailable
63-
- mountPoint: search.page.results
64-
importName: TechDocsSearchResultListItem
65-
- mountPoint: search.page.filters
66-
importName: TechdocsSearchFilter
67-
- mountPoint: search.page.types
68-
importName: techdocsSearchType
69-
config:
70-
props:
71-
name: Documentation
72-
icon: docs
30+
- title: Default configuration
31+
content:
32+
dynamicPlugins:
33+
frontend:
34+
backstage.plugin-techdocs:
35+
routeBindings:
36+
targets:
37+
- importName: techdocsPlugin
38+
bindings:
39+
- bindTarget: catalogPlugin.externalRoutes
40+
bindMap:
41+
viewTechDoc: techdocsPlugin.routes.docRoot
42+
- bindTarget: scaffolderPlugin.externalRoutes
43+
bindMap:
44+
viewTechDoc: techdocsPlugin.routes.docRoot
45+
dynamicRoutes:
46+
- path: /docs
47+
importName: TechDocsIndexPage
48+
menuItem:
49+
icon: docs
50+
text: Docs
51+
textKey: menuItem.docs
52+
- path: /docs/:namespace/:kind/:name/*
53+
importName: TechDocsReaderPage
54+
mountPoints:
55+
- mountPoint: entity.page.docs/cards
56+
importName: EntityTechdocsContent
57+
config:
58+
layout:
59+
gridColumn: 1 / -1
60+
if:
61+
allOf:
62+
- isTechDocsAvailable
63+
- mountPoint: search.page.results
64+
importName: TechDocsSearchResultListItem
65+
- mountPoint: search.page.filters
66+
importName: TechdocsSearchFilter
67+
- mountPoint: search.page.types
68+
importName: techdocsSearchType
69+
config:
70+
props:
71+
name: Documentation
72+
icon: docs

workspaces/bulk-import/metadata/red-hat-developer-hub-backstage-plugin-bulk-import.yaml

Lines changed: 29 additions & 25 deletions
Original file line numberDiff line numberDiff line change
@@ -3,20 +3,19 @@ kind: Package
33
metadata:
44
name: red-hat-developer-hub-backstage-plugin-bulk-import
55
namespace: rhdh
6-
title: "Bulk Import Frontend"
6+
title: Bulk Import Frontend
77
links:
8-
- url: https://red.ht/rhdh
9-
title: Homepage
10-
- url: https://issues.redhat.com/browse/RHIDP
11-
title: Bugs
12-
- title: Source Code
13-
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-bulk-import
8+
- url: https://red.ht/rhdh
9+
title: Homepage
10+
- url: https://issues.redhat.com/browse/RHIDP
11+
title: Bugs
12+
- title: Source Code
13+
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-bulk-import
1414
annotations:
15-
backstage.io/source-location: url
16-
https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-bulk-import
15+
backstage.io/source-location: url https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-bulk-import
1716
tags: []
1817
spec:
19-
packageName: "@red-hat-developer-hub/backstage-plugin-bulk-import"
18+
packageName: '@red-hat-developer-hub/backstage-plugin-bulk-import'
2019
dynamicArtifact: ./dynamic-plugins/dist/red-hat-developer-hub-backstage-plugin-bulk-import
2120
version: 1.18.1
2221
backstage:
@@ -26,19 +25,24 @@ spec:
2625
support: tech-preview
2726
lifecycle: active
2827
partOf:
29-
- bulk-import
28+
- bulk-import
3029
appConfigExamples:
31-
- title: Default configuration
32-
content:
33-
dynamicPlugins:
34-
frontend:
35-
red-hat-developer-hub.backstage-plugin-bulk-import:
36-
appIcons:
37-
- name: bulkImportIcon
38-
importName: BulkImportIcon
39-
dynamicRoutes:
40-
- path: /bulk-import/repositories
41-
importName: BulkImportPage
42-
menuItem:
43-
icon: bulkImportIcon
44-
text: Bulk import
30+
- title: Default configuration
31+
content:
32+
dynamicPlugins:
33+
frontend:
34+
red-hat-developer-hub.backstage-plugin-bulk-import:
35+
translationResources:
36+
- importName: bulkImportTranslations
37+
module: Alpha
38+
ref: bulkImportTranslationRef
39+
appIcons:
40+
- name: bulkImportIcon
41+
importName: BulkImportIcon
42+
dynamicRoutes:
43+
- path: /bulk-import/repositories
44+
importName: BulkImportPage
45+
menuItem:
46+
icon: bulkImportIcon
47+
text: Bulk import
48+
textKey: menuItem.bulkImport

workspaces/global-floating-action-button/metadata/red-hat-developer-hub-backstage-plugin-global-floating-action-b.yaml

Lines changed: 21 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-3,20 +3,19 @@ kind: Package
33
metadata:
44
name: red-hat-developer-hub-backstage-plugin-global-floating-action-b
55
namespace: rhdh
6-
title: "Global Floating Action B"
6+
title: Global Floating Action B
77
links:
8-
- url: https://red.ht/rhdh
9-
title: Homepage
10-
- url: https://issues.redhat.com/browse/RHIDP
11-
title: Bugs
12-
- title: Source Code
13-
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-global-floating-action-button
8+
- url: https://red.ht/rhdh
9+
title: Homepage
10+
- url: https://issues.redhat.com/browse/RHIDP
11+
title: Bugs
12+
- title: Source Code
13+
url: https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-global-floating-action-button
1414
annotations:
15-
backstage.io/source-location: url
16-
https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-global-floating-action-button
15+
backstage.io/source-location: url https://github.com/redhat-developer/rhdh/tree/main/dynamic-plugins/wrappers/red-hat-developer-hub-backstage-plugin-global-floating-action-button
1716
tags: []
1817
spec:
19-
packageName: "@red-hat-developer-hub/backstage-plugin-global-floating-action-button"
18+
packageName: '@red-hat-developer-hub/backstage-plugin-global-floating-action-button'
2019
dynamicArtifact: ./dynamic-plugins/dist/red-hat-developer-hub-backstage-plugin-global-floating-action-button
2120
version: 1.5.0
2221
backstage:
@@ -26,13 +25,16 @@ spec:
2625
support: production
2726
lifecycle: active
2827
partOf:
29-
- global-floating-action-button
28+
- global-floating-action-button
3029
appConfigExamples:
31-
- title: Default configuration
32-
content:
33-
dynamicPlugins:
34-
frontend:
35-
red-hat-developer-hub.backstage-plugin-global-floating-action-button:
36-
mountPoints:
37-
- mountPoint: application/listener
38-
importName: DynamicGlobalFloatingActionButton
30+
- title: Default configuration
31+
content:
32+
dynamicPlugins:
33+
frontend:
34+
red-hat-developer-hub.backstage-plugin-global-floating-action-button:
35+
translationResources:
36+
- importName: globalFloatingActionButtonTranslations
37+
ref: globalFloatingActionButtonTranslationRef
38+
mountPoints:
39+
- mountPoint: application/listener
40+
importName: DynamicGlobalFloatingActionButton

0 commit comments

Comments
 (0)